In July 2016, the passenger flow at Vnukovo airport decreased by 18.9% to 1.593 million from 1.965 million in July 2015, the company's press service informed.
The passenger flow on domestic air routes was 1.184 million, the number of international passengers was 409 thousand. Last month, the airport served 14,625 flights.
In July, the airport processed 3,922 tonnes of cargoes and mail (+6.2% year-on-year).
The most popular domestic destinations were Sochi, Simferopol, Anapa, St. Petersburg, Krasnodar, Makhachkala and Rostov-on-Don.
The airport added a number of new destinations to its international route network: Sanya (China), Hйvнz, Phuket and Punta Cana. The number of flights to the Mediterranean countries, as well as to Iran, Azerbaijan and Central Asia increased.
JSC International Airport Vnukovo (tax number: 7710404473) is one of the largest air transportation complexes of Russia annually handling more than 150,000 flights of Russian and foreign airline companies. The flight geography covers the whole of Russia as well as the CIS countries, Western Europe, Asia, Africa, and North America. Russia's Federal Agency for State Property Management holds 74.74% of Vnukovo shares.
In 2015, Vnukovo airport increased passenger throughput by 25% year-on-year to 15.8 million.
According to the DataCapital information retrieval system, RAS net loss of JSC International Airport Vnukovo for 2015 increased 78.59 times to RUB 107.278 million from RUB 1.365 million the year before. Revenue decreased by 1.01% to RUB 889.321 million from RUB 898.35 million, sales loss was RUB 18.809 million against a profit of RUB 59.185 million in 2014, loss before tax amounted to RUB 99.372 million against a profit of RUB 4.046 million.
